The Arizona Cardinals are 2-5 and the fans are somehow more confident after another loss.
It is interesting that losing with shiny stats makes some feel like things are ok.
When in reality, the defense is and has been the biggest issue this year. People got thinking early that the points per game was a real thing, when they were bottom third of the NFL in yards per game allowed. Eventually it would come back to the points being scored as well.
Yet, fans like the slightly higher scoring losses, even if it is a miniscule bump from 10 to 12%.
